                You are driving your car along a country road at a speed of 21.5 m/s.
As you come over the crest of a hill, you notice a farm tractor 35.7 m
ahead of you on the road, moving in the same direction as you at a speed of 10.0 m/s.
You immediately slam on your brakes and slow down with a constant acceleration of magnitude 7.00 m/s2.
Will you hit the tractor before you stop? How far will you travel before you stop or collide with the tractor? If you stop, how far is the tractor in front of you when you finally stop?
Q1: distance car requires to stop? (m)
Q2: if you stop, how far is the tractor in front of you?
